In a striking turn of events, Melania Trump, the former First Lady, recently took the stage at the White House to emphatically reject any associations with the controversial financier Jeffrey Epstein. Her announcement, made on April 9, included a heartfelt appeal for congressional hearings to address the plight of Epstein’s victims, igniting a significant political discourse. However, despite this high-profile declaration, the cryptocurrency market saw an unexpected reaction as her associated memecoin experienced a dramatic plunge, losing a staggering 99% of its value.

The memecoin, which had gained traction as a novelty in the crypto space, seemed to be riding the waves of its connection to the Trump brand. Yet, the recent market dynamics reveal the volatile nature of cryptocurrencies, particularly those tied to celebrity endorsements. The swift decline in value following Melania’s address showcases not only the unpredictable landscape of memecoins but also the broader uncertainties surrounding speculative assets in the crypto market.
